23 Hours ago Barnsley Football Club can confirm that Jordan Helliwell, Steven Simpson, Charlie Winfield and Matty Wolfe are to join Esbjerg fB on loan, until 31 December 2021. The young quartet will link up with the NordicBet League outfit, as EfB set their sights on a return to the Danish top flight. Under 23s, Matty Wolfe, who made his first team debut during the 19/20 season against Nottingham Forest and Jordan Helliwell, Barnsley FC’s 17/18 Academy Player of the Year, move to benefit and grow from regular exposure to the men’s game. Charlie Winfield is another U23’s player who will benefit from exposure to senior football. Highly thought of at Oakwell, the versatile left-back has been on the books since 2012. ....

× BARNSLEY chief executive Dane Murphy is confident that out-of-contract captain Alex Mowatt and sought-after head coach Valerien Ismael will still be at Oakwell next season. Ismael, who masterminded the Reds’ rise from fourth-bottom in October to fifth in the final Championship table, before play-off defeat to Swansea, has been linked with a move to various clubs including Crystal Palace, where he played, and West Bromwich Albion. The Frenchman – who has been on a family holiday to Dubai – has two years left on his contract while there have been reports of a release clause which Murphy would not comment on. Murphy told the Chronicle: “I haven’t seen or heard anything that would dissuade me from believing Valerien is going to be the head coach next season of Barnsley Football Club. ....
